A class 1 forklift is an electric counterbalanced 3-wheel or 4-wheel lift truck that comes in both stand-up and sit-down models. They come with both cushion and pneumatic tires …
WebJun 5, 2024 · Forklifts are categorized by their class, which ranges from 1 to 7. Here we will only be focusing on class 2 forklifts, also known as electric narrow aisle trucks. Narrow aisle forklifts are built to work in areas narrower than 12 feet. They have cushion tires that are airless rubber tires, which means they are only operated indoors. WebOct 9, 2024 · The fifth forklift class is the Internal Combustion Engine Trucks with Pneumatic Tires. It’s similar to class number four, but with different tires. The pneumatic tires are designed for outdoor use or rough terrain. They run on liquid propane, gas, or diesel.
